It sounds lovely and in need of a hug.cuddly which all grouches need from time to time 2 likes · like 1 comment 6 years ago dffh pay scaleWebAnatole is a French male name, derived from the Greek name Ανατολιος Anatolius, meaning "sunrise." The Russian version of the name is Anatoly (also transliterated as Anatoliy and Anatoli ). Other variants are Anatol and more rarely Anatolio .
